Creating MP3 music files
Using MusicMatch, you can copy the tracks from a musicCD to your
computer’s hard drive as MP3 files. MP3 (MPEG Layer3) is a standard for
digitally compressing high-fidelity music into compact files without noticeably
sacrificing quality. MP3 files end in th e file ext ension .MP3.

To create MP3 files:

1To have MusicMatch automatically list the album, artist, and track names
of your CD, then use that information for naming and storing your MP3
files, connect to the Internet before inserting your CD.
2Insert a music CD into your CD or DVD drive.
Important Some musicCDs have copy protection software. You
cannot copy tracks from these CDs.
